Oceania Digital Textile Printer Market

Oceania’s digital textile printing market will grow rapidly between 2023-2033 at a CAGR rate of 4.3%. The market is expected to reach a value of $150 million by the year 2033. The market’s value will likely surpass US$ 98,4 million by 2023.

Future Market Insights predicts that Oceania’s demand for digital textile print will grow as a result the growing ecommerce distribution sector. E-commerce allows small and medium textile producers to easily reach a large consumer base.

E-commerce distribution has been most beneficial to people who live in rural or underserved regions. Digital textile printing technology is able to meet this demand.

The textile industry has seen a rise in demand for customisation and personalization due to the e-commerce. It is partly due to the fact that users have more choices because of the ease and capacity of using the internet interface.

Digital textile printing is a flexible technique that can be used for both the design and production of specialized and customized goods.

E-commerce sites are also fueling the demand for sustainable fabrics as consumers become increasingly aware of their impact on the environment.

In the last few years, using less water and reducing energy and chemical usage has become commonplace in industry. Digital textile printing is therefore more environmentally friendly than conventional textile printing.

Due to stiff competition on this market, the demand for affordable and versatile printing options is increasing. The stiff competition in this market has encouraged small and medium businesses to adopt digital printing technology for textiles at an accelerated rate. This trend will continue to drive market growth in the future.

Digital Textile Printing Market Landscape and Competitive Landscape

Oceania’s digital textile market is characterized by a number of strategies adopted by players to stay competitive. Consolidation is one of the major strategies, but there are also other moves such as acquisitions, mergers, and product innovation.

HP Inc., Brother International Corporation, Seiko Epson Corporation, Konica Minolta, Inc., Colorjet Group, The M&R Companies, Mimaki Engineering Co., Ltd., Aeoon Technologies GmbH, HGS Machines, Ricoh Company, Ltd, Electronics for Imaging, Inc., Kornit Digital, and others are prominent players in the digital textile printing market. The digital textile printing industry is fragmented, and Tier 1 players hold 20-25% of the Oceania market.

As an example

  • In October 2021, Kornit Digital announced a new partnership with Amazon, which will allow Amazon sellers to access Kornit’s digital textile printing technology to create and sell customized printed apparel.
